City. - made by Judge Cox, of the circuit dfts ences." shall proceed by action against tbe owner or person in cnarge ol trespass ing animals, he shall get two dis interested persons ol ais precinct to, appraise the damages and to give blm a certificate thereof in writing under their bands. Which certificate .shall acc mpao y the complaint as a part thereof, and under no circum stances shall he recover of tlie defendant in such action unless such appraisal and certificate shall be made withiu ten flays after tne time such trespass was committed, nor to a greater amount ot damages than tee amount named In such certificate." Tbe determination ot the amount of the damages done By a. tVcspessing animal is a jadlctnl ct Hence tbe two appraisers provided for In this section mfe constituted a court with power to make a decree, which, the section say, sball be final ; that is, it provides that tbe Judgment ot the appraisers as to tbe amount ot damage done, shall be the limit of the amount which plaintiff may recover In the event ot an action at law. Under the laws of Congress applicable to this Territory, the only courts that can have any .existence within it are lu tices', U. S. commissioners' probate, district, and the Territorial Supreme. The Legislative Assembly of this Territory has no authority to vest Judicial' powers in anv other offThis icers or triDunals than.thrse. point is made clear in Judge Emerson's somewhat noted decision respecting the Water Commissioners, provided for by Territorial statute tor tbe purpose ot determining title to water. In that decision it Is explained that Judicial functions can only be exercised by the courts provided for by Congressional legislation. The demurrer of the defense, based on the above section, was overruled, Judge Zane holding that provision of our estray law to be unconstitutional, for the reasons above indicated.
